System Capacity
The PARTNER ACS release you have, the carrier you use, and the combination
of modules installed, determine the number of available lines and extensions.
PARTNER ACS Release 7.0 allows up to 31 lines and up to 48 extensions.
However, these maximums cannot be achieved simultaneously.
If you want to install a PARTNER Messaging or PARTNER MAIL VS
module, keep in mind that the module uses one of the slots in the
carrier, which reduces the system line and extension capacity.

Wall-Mounting a Stand-Alone Processor Module and a 2-Slot
Carrier
Install the processor module within 5 feet (1.5 meters) of a properly grounded
wall outlet (not controlled by a switch) and the network interface jacks.
14
Evaluating the Environment
Quick Reference Guide
2 Installing Your System
Follow these steps to wall-mount the module(s):
1 Using the enclosed template, mark the screw locations on the wall.
2 Hold the processor module against the wall with the line and extension
jacks facing left. Leave at least 1 foot (0.3 meter) clearance at the top, front,
and right side, and at least 2 feet (0.6 meter) at the bottom and left side.
3 Insert a #8 sheet metal screw into the screw hole at the top of the processor
module.
4 If you are installing a second module, go to Step 5. If you are not installing a
second module (stand-alone configuration):
a Insert another #8 sheet metal screw into the screw hole at the bottom of
the module.
b Tighten the screws until the mounting tracks are snug against the wall.
There must be a 3/8 inch (1 cm) gap between the wall and the rest of the
module. Do not overtighten the screws or the module will warp and fail to
operate.
5 Remove the clear plastic protectors from the connectors on the right side of
the wall-mounted PARTNER ACS processor module and the module to be
added by grasping the tabs on the ends of the protector and lifting.
6 Slide the second module onto the PARTNER ACS processor module,
making sure the mounting tracks interlock.
7 Attach the 2-slot carrier to the top right side of the two modules, properly
engaging the connectors on the modules to the carrier.
8 Fasten the carrier to the modules by using the two #4 screws included with
the carrier.
9 Insert the 3-1/2 inch #8 screw into the bottom of the modules. Tighten it until
the mounting tracks of the PARTNER ACS processor module are flush
against the wall. Do not overtighten or the module will warp. Then go to the

Wall-Mounting a 5-Slot Carrier and Modules
Install the 5-slot carrier within 5 feet (1.5 meters) of a properly grounded wall
outlet (not controlled by a switch) and the network interface jacks. When you
mount the carrier on the wall, leave at least 1 foot (0.3 meter) of clearance at the
top and sides and 2 feet (0.6 meter) at the front and bottom to ensure proper
ventilation.
The location of each module within the carrier is important; place the
modules as instructed in the following procedure.
Follow these steps to wall-mount the 5-slot carrier and modules:
1 Using the enclosed template, mark the screw locations on the wall. If you
are mounting the carrier on plywood, start four #12 screws supplied with the
carrier, leaving the screw heads extending approximately 1/4 inch (0.64 cm)
from the wall. If you are mounting on drywall, use wall anchors, which must
be purchased separately.
2 Before installing any modules, make sure the clear, plastic protector has
been removed from the connector area on the rear of each module. To
remove the protector, grasp the tabs on the ends of the protector and lift.
3 Insert the PARTNER ACS processor module in the center slot of the carrier.
4 In the other slots, from left to right, first install the T1 module (if used) or
1600 DSL module (if used), then the 012E, 308EC, or 206 modules,
followed by the 400 or 200 modules and/or a PARTNER Messaging or
PARTNER MAIL VS module. Align the module carefully in the appropriate
slot. For proper engagement of the connectors, the module must be
inserted straight into the carrier. Once the module is properly seated, firmly
push the center of the module until the connectors on the module lock into
place. A slight click indicates the connectors are engaged.
16
Installing the Control Unit
Quick Reference Guide
2 Installing Your System
· If you use a T1 module, it must be in the first slot on the left. The
012E, 308EC, and 206 modules must be to the left of any 400
and 200 modules. Only one T1 module is supported.
· If you use a 1600 DSL module, it must be in the first slot on the
left. The 012E, 308EC, and 206 modules must be to the left of
any 400 and 200 modules. Only one DSL module is supported.
· PARTNER ACS Release 7.0 supports either one T1 module or
one 1600 DSL module.
· PARTNER ACS Release 7.0 supports Endeavor telephones and
the Endeavor 362EC module. Install the Endeavor 362EC
module(s) to the right of the T1 module or 1600 DSL module, if
one is installed, and to the left of all 400 and 200 modules.
· In Release 7.0, the system extension maximum is 48. However,
in some configurations, the 012E module and/or the PARTNER
Messaging module will physically permit more than 48 stations
to be installed in the 5-slot carrier. In these configurations, only
station ports and voice messaging ports up to 48 will function.
Station ports and voice messaging ports above 48 will not
function with ETR or T/R telephones because they are outside
the PARTNER ACS dial plan.
CAUTION:
Do not force the module. Use the carrier shelf as a reference and do
not tilt, slant, or rotate the module. If the module does not insert easily,
remove it, clear any obstruction, and reinsert it.

Labeling Jacks
After you have mounted the control unit on the wall, you must label the line and
extension jacks. The line jacks are on the top of the modules, and the extension
jacks on the bottom.
Follow these steps to label the line and extension jacks:
1 Label the line jacks on the processor module, beginning with "1" at the top
line jack.
2 Do one of the following:
· For a 2-slot carrier, label the line jacks on the other module.
· For a 5-slot carrier, label the line jacks on the other modules by starting
with the leftmost module and ending with the rightmost module.
· Although a T1 module has only one line jack, it supports up
to 16 lines. Therefore, the line jacks on the module to the
right of a T1 module in a 5-slot carrier are numbered starting
with "22."
· Although a 1600 DSL module has only one line jack, it
supports up to 16 lines. Therefore, the line jacks on the
module to the right of a 1600 DSL module in a 5-slot carrier
are numbered starting with "22."
3 Label the extension jacks on the processor module, beginning with "10" at
the topmost extension jack.
4 Do one of the following:
· For a 2-slot carrier, label the extension jacks on the other module.
· For a 5-slot carrier, label the extension jacks on the other modules by
starting with the leftmost module and ending with the rightmost module.

Grounding the System
You ground the system by running a solid copper wire from the processor
module to an appropriate earth ground. Follow these steps to ground the system:
1 Attach one end of a #12 AWG or #14 AWG solid copper wire to the
grounding screw on the processor module. The length of the wire must not
exceed 35 feet (7.6 meters).
2 Route the wire through the wire manager on the front of the module.
3 Attach the other end of the wire to the approved earth ground, such as
building steel or a cold water pipe.
Inserting Batteries in the Processor Module
The processor module uses two AAA-size standard alkaline batteries to guard
against the loss of system programming in case of a power failure. These
batteries retain the system programming for 45 days to six months, depending
on the freshness of the batteries. You should replace the batteries every year.
The configuration of the 1600 DSL module is not backed up to the
PCMCIA card. Instead, the configuration is retained in the flash memory
of the 1600 DSL module.
CAUTION:
Batteries and battery cover are packaged in a separate box. If you are
replacing batteries, the old batteries must be removed with the power on or
the system's memory will be lost.
Follow these steps to insert the batteries:
1 Locate the battery compartment at the bottom of the PARTNER ACS
processor module, below the extension jacks.
2 Push gently on the battery icon (the locking latch) and slide the battery icon
up to cover the plus icon; this unlocks the battery assembly.
3 Remove the battery assembly by gently pulling the tab at the bottom of the
battery compartment cover.
Installing the Control Unit
19
2 Installing Your System
Quick Reference Guide
4 Insert two new AAA-size standard alkaline batteries into the metal battery
clips by pushing them straight in, placing the negative () end of one battery
into the bottom clip and the positive (+) end of the other battery into the top
clip.
5 With the locking latch in the unlocked position (battery icon and "minus"
icon visible), slide the battery assembly into the processor module along
the battery guides on the inside of the battery compartment. Push the
battery assembly in far enough that the edges of the assembly slip behind
the plastic housing of the processor module.
6 Pressing lightly on the battery icon on the front of the battery assembly,
slide the locking latch downward to secure the assembly in place. The
"plus" icon and the battery icon should now be visible on the front of the
battery assembly.

Initializing the System
Before you initialize the system, you may insert any of the supported PC cards:
Backup/Restore card, Automatic System Answer/Direct Extension Dial
(ASA/DXD) card, PARTNER Voice Messaging Basics card, and PARTNER
Remote Access PC Card.
You must power down the system before you insert or remove a PC
Card.
Follow these steps to initialize a system:
1 If you have a PC Card, perform the following steps:
a If your PC Card comes with a write-protect tab, verify that the
write-protect tab on the PC Card is not in the write-protected position. If it
is, use a paperclip or another pointed object to push the write-protect tab
on the end of the PC Card upward to the nonprotected position.
b To insert the PC Card, hold it with the label facing to the right, and slide it
gently into one of the PC Card slots on the processor module. When
inserted properly, the PC Card projects about 1-5/8" (4 cm) from the
module.
2 If you have a 5-slot carrier, make sure the carrier's On/Off switch is at the
Off ("O") position.
3 Press the power cord firmly into the power jack on the carrier or the
stand-alone processor module until the cord locks into place.
4 Plug the other end of the power cord into a properly grounded three-prong
wall outlet that is not controlled by a switch.
5 If you have a 5-slot carrier, move the On/Off switch to the On ("--") position.
CAUTION:
The power cord should hang straight down from the connector for the
entire length of the module or carrier. Do not install the power cord at
an angle to the case or with a loop in it.
Installing the Control Unit
21
2 Installing Your System
Quick Reference Guide
· If your system has a 1600 DSL module, initialization of the
line and extension ports may take up to 40 seconds. The
initialization of the 1600 DSL module itself may take from 2 to
7 minutes
· If your system has a T1 module, initialization may take up to
one minute.
Checking the LEDs
After you power up your system, check the green lights on the fronts of the
modules:
· If a single light is out, power down the control unit, reseat the module, and
then power up the carrier.
· If multiple lights are out, power down the carrier, reseat either both modules
(2-slot carrier) or the leftmost module that has a light out (5-slot carrier), and
then power up the carrier.
If the lights are still out, see the "Customer Support Document" on the
accompanying compact disc for information about whom you should contact.

Connecting the Loudspeaker Paging System
Perform the steps in this section if you have a loudspeaker paging system.
Loudspeaker paging systems allow you to broadcast a message over a large
area. The PARTNER system supports all Avaya paging systems, including the
entire PagePac line. The PARTNER system also supports most paging systems
from other manufacturers when the paging systems are connected using a
paging interface device.
If you connect a loudspeaker paging system from another
manufacturer, a paging interface may be required.
Follow these steps to connect a loudspeaker paging system to the PARTNER
system:
1 Insert the modular plug from the loudspeaker paging system into an
available line jack on a PARTNER module. A loudspeaker paging system
can be connected to a line jack on the following PARTNER modules:
· PARTNER ACS R7.0 processor module
· 308EC module
· 400E module, 400EC module
· 200e module
· 206 module, 206E module, 206EC module
· 362EC module
Connecting the Loudspeaker Paging System
25
2 Installing Your System
Quick Reference Guide
· It is recommended that you connect the loudspeaker paging
system to the highest numbered line jack in your PARTNER
system to help prevent any future conflict with your line
assignments. When you connect a loudspeaker paging
system to a line jack on the PARTNER system, that line is
"unavailable." For example, suppose your system has four
lines, and you connect your loudspeaker paging system to
line jack 4. (The lines are connected to Line jack 1, Line jack
2, Line jack 3 and Line jack 5.) When you administer the
lines, the PARTNER system will label these four lines as Line
1, Line 2, Line 3, and Line 5. Line 4 is unavailable.
· If the loudspeaker paging system requires a "dry contact
relay," you must connect the loudspeaker paging system to
line jack 5 on the PARTNER ACS R7.0 processor module.
2 Route the cord through the processor module's wire manager.
3 Connect the other end of the cord to the paging system.

System Programming Basics
After the control unit is installed, you set up the system by using a combination of
the following two types of programming. Use the System Planning Guide when
programming.
· System Programming allows you to customize the system to meet the
needs of your business. When the system is first installed, it uses factory
settings that reflect the most commonly used options. You can change
system settings as needed.
You can perform System Programming from extension 10 or extension 11.
Because an extension cannot be in programming mode and handle calls at
the same time, you should use extension 11 for programming. By doing so,
you can program without disrupting call handling at extension 10.
· Telephone Programming allows telephones to be customized to meet
individual users' needs. There are two types of Telephone Programming,
depending from where you program.
-- Centralized Telephone Programming--programming individual
telephones from extension 10 or 11.
-- Extension Programming--programming an individual system
telephone from the extension to which it is connected.
· With the PARTNER ACS R7.0 PC Administration software, you can
perform system programming and telephone programming,
enabling you to administer and maintain the PARTNER system from
your PC.
· If the PARTNER system has a T1 module, you must use the
PARTNER ACS R7.0 PC Administration software to configure the
T1 module.
You need a system display telephone for System and Centralized Telephone
Programming. If you have any 34-button telephones in the system, you must use
a 34-button display telephone to program since an 18-button telephone cannot
be used to program a 34-button telephone. Also, if your system has both
PARTNER and MLS telephones, you should use a PARTNER display telephone
at the programming extension.
